Boston airport: Man held, tried to enter cockpit
BOSTON – A man has been arrested in Boston after allegedly trying to enter the cockpit of an Air Wisconsin commuter jet flying from Maine to Philadelphia.
Airport spokesman Phil Orlandella says the plane was diverted to Boston's Logan International Airport after other passengers restrained the unruly man. Orlandella says the man was arrested by state police and could face charges of interfering with a flight crew.
Orlandella says the flight from Portland, Maine, had 50 passengers and three crew members.
